About the Position


The Senior Production Engineer Offshore is responsible for ensuring offshore wells and facilities operate safely, reliably, and at optimal performance. This role leads production surveillance, data quality assurance, and performance diagnostics, translating insights into actionable optimization and reliability improvements. Working within ENGINE, the Senior Production Engineer partners closely with global Offshore Operations, Regional Production Engineering, Asset Development (AD), and Subsurface teams to deliver high-quality surveillance products (dashboards, well and facility performance assessments, exception analyses) and to drive short cycle optimization, troubleshooting, and production improvement initiatives.


With 1015 years of experience, the role is expected to independently execute and continuously improve surveillance and data workflows, diagnose complex well and facility performance issues, and recommend technically sound solutions. The Senior Production Engineer serves as a technical authority for production performance, mentors early career engineers, and proactively escalates and influences resolution of high impact risks and opportunities across the asset.

Key Responsibilities


Serve as the technical lead for offshore production engineering, setting priorities and driving work that improves production, reliability, and integrity across the asset life cycle.

Lead advanced production surveillance for complex offshore systems (subsea wells, platforms, and facilities) by establishing surveillance plans, tracking KPI performance and production losses, and regularly communicating insights and recommendations to regional production engineering and asset teams.

Evaluate and support well stimulation programs (e.g., acid treatments) by defining candidate selection criteria, maintaining candidate lists and productivity index tracking, supporting job design and execution reviews, and completing post job performance assessments with documented learnings.

Perform and steward Pressure Transient Analysis (PTA) and Rate Transient Analysis (RTA) to diagnose well/reservoir performance, quantify deliverability and skin impacts, and translate results into recommendations and model updates using automation and analytics tools (e.g., SA&O tool suite, Kappa Automate).

Build, calibrate, and maintain integrated well, network, and facility models to identify constraints, test operating scenarios, optimize production targets, and support operational and investment decisions.

Compile and interpret waterflood surveillance data (injection and production trends, pattern response, and sweep indicators) and translate findings into field level and well level optimization recommendations and follow up actions.

Partner with Asset Development (AD) in Offshore Regions, and subsurface teams to standardize production engineering workflows, align on technical decision criteria, and share lessons learned and best practices across assets.

Coach and mentor ENGINE production engineers through technical reviews, problem-solving support, and development of reusable templates and guidance to strengthen analytical capability.

Ensure work complies with safety, operational integrity, and environmental requirements by following approved procedures, participating in risk assessments, and supporting Management of Change (MOC) and integrity processes as required.


Required Qualifications


Bachelors degree in Petroleum Engineering, Chemical Engineering, Mechanical Engineering, or a related engineering discipline.

Masters degree in Petroleum Engineering or another engineering discipline, preferred.

10+ years of experience in production engineering.

Demonstrated experience executing production surveillance, well optimization, and system diagnostics for producing assets.

Working knowledge of well stimulation design and evaluation (screening candidates, selecting treatment types, and interpreting post treatment response).

Demonstrated knowledge in Pressure Transient Analysis (PTA) and Rate Transient Analysis (RTA) is a plus, including interpretation and translation of results into actionable recommendations.

Demonstrated knowledge of well productivity analysis under flowing conditions (e.g., nodal analysis, IPR/VLP concepts, and operating envelope impacts).
